题目

实现 int sqrt(int x) 函数。

计算并返回 x 的平方根,其中 x 是非负整数。

由于返回类型是整数,结果只保留整数的部分,小数部分将被舍去。

示例 1:

输入: 4
输出: 2

示例 2:

输入: 8
输出: 2
说明: 8 的平方根是 2.82842...

由于返回类型是整数,小数部分将被舍去。

代码(C语言)

有点犯规了,不过既然返回int…

int mySqrt(int x)
{long long int i;for(i=0;i<=x;i++){if(i*i<=x&&(i+1)*(i+1)>x)return i;}return 0;
}

leetcode 69. x 的平方根(C语言)相关推荐

  1. LeetCode 69. x 的平方根:二分查找法实现自定义的函数:x 的平方根

    LeetCode 69. x 的平方根:二分查找法实现自定义的函数:x 的平方根 题目描述 实现 int sqrt(int x) 函数. 计算并返回 x 的平方根,其中 x 是非负整数. 由于返回类型 ...

  2. LeetCode #69 x的平方根 二分查找

    LeetCode #69 x的平方根 题目描述 实现 int sqrt(int x) 函数. 计算并返回 x 的平方根,其中 x 是非负整数. 由于返回类型是整数,结果只保留整数的部分,小数部分将被舍 ...

  3. LeetCode - 69. x 的平方根

    69. x 的平方根 class Solution {private static final Integer MAX_POW = 46340;/*** 牛顿迭代* f(x) = x^2 - n* 切 ...

  4. LeetCode 69. x 的平方根(二分查找)

    文章目录 1. 题目 2.解题 2.1 二分查找 2.2 牛顿迭代 1. 题目 实现 int sqrt(int x) 函数. 计算并返回 x 的平方根,其中 x 是非负整数. 由于返回类型是整数,结果 ...

  5. LeetCode——69 x的平方根

    问题描述: 实现 int sqrt(int x) 函数.计算并返回 x 的平方根,其中 x 是非负整数.由于返回类型是整数,结果只保留整数的部分,小数部分将被舍去. 示例 1: 输入: 4 输出: 2 ...

  6. Leetcode 69 x的平方根 (每日一题 20210805)

    实现 int sqrt(int x) 函数.计算并返回 x 的平方根,其中 x 是非负整数.由于返回类型是整数,结果只保留整数的部分,小数部分将被舍去.示例 1:输入: 4 输出: 2 示例 2:输入 ...

  7. LeetCode 69 X的平方根

    原题 解题思路:二分法 class Solution { public:int mySqrt(int x) {long long i=0;long long j=x/2+1;//x的平方根不大于x/2 ...

  8. leetcode 69. x 的平方根 思考分析

    题目 实现 int sqrt(int x) 函数. 计算并返回 x 的平方根,其中 x 是非负整数. 由于返回类型是整数,结果只保留整数的部分,小数部分将被舍去. 示例 1: 输入: 4 输出: 2 ...

  9. LeetCode 69 x 的平方根

    题目描述 实现 int sqrt(int x) 函数. 计算并返回 x 的平方根,其中 x 是非负整数. 由于返回类型是整数,结果只保留整数的部分,小数部分将被舍去. 题解 使用二分查找. 代码 cl ...

最新文章

  1. sap.ui.layout.HorizontalLayout is not a constructor
  2. Windows 11 预览版 Build 22000.168 发布
  3. 使用 C# 9 的records作为强类型ID - 初次使用
  4. Codeforces Round #742 (Div. 2) F. One-Four Overload 构造 + 二分图染色
  5. ThinkPHP3.2.3快速入门 · 看云
  6. 从lambda表达式看final关键字
  7. 如何成为更优秀的工程师?
  8. 闭合导线平差计算(表面)
  9. CAJ论文怎么打开?
  10. 以码为梦,心向远方,路在脚下|211应届计算机毕业生的迷茫
  11. xp如何在电脑上设置无线网络连接服务器,xp电脑怎么设置wifi
  12. WBADMIN 命令手册
  13. 不羞涩社区图片爬取,我真的不是为了看小姐姐私照,从未这么渴望过知识!
  14. tl-wdr7300虚拟服务器怎么设置,TP-Link TL-WDR7300路由器wifi密码怎么设置?(电脑)...
  15. linux系统文件信息系统满,在Deepin系统中提示系统盘已经满了(/home文件大)的解决方案...
  16. IOS学习笔记56-IOS7状态栏适配方法一
  17. python定义一个dog类 类属性有名字_python 基础 12 初识类,类方法,类属性
  18. ubuntu里的桌面便签工具
  19. html怎么创建盒子,html布局(盒子)
  20. 宝马X6和保时捷卡宴,选谁更加高端大气上档次?

热门文章

  1. 太阳能充电调节代码_太阳能LED路灯控制器有什么作用
  2. 几何基础之点在多边形内的判断
  3. 贪心算法-02活动安排问题
  4. 二进制位交换,反转,与统计1的个数
  5. C++中placement new操作符(经典)
  6. 【玩转cocos2d-x之八】精灵类CCSprite
  7. COM编程之二 接口
  8. 使用LeakTracer检测android NDK C/C++代码中的memory leak
  9. 个推异常值检测和实战应用
  10. 可算是有文章,把Linux零拷贝讲透彻了!